Facts and figures so far

28/48 games played
7/28 games won by German side, 2 in St Remy and 5 in Crenwik
20/28 games won by French side, 13 in St Remy and 7 in Crenwik
1/28 games Draw, in Crenwik

In Group 1 KingT only needs 1 more flag to secure a place in the semi-finals, while Navaronegun must capture all 8 flags in his remaining games and kill more enemy units than KingT to reach the semi-final.

Group 2 is still to be decided. All three have played 3 out of 8 games. Jcb and Collier got a small lead with 8 flags each while Morge got 4 flags.

In Group 3 it seems like Zarevic has a place in the semi-finals, but he still needs 2 more flags to secure his place, because if Pomakli capture all flags in his remaining 6 games he will get 24 flags. Zarevics "only" got 23 with 2 games left to finish.

And in Group 4 Wegeberg has finish all his games and ended in capturing 17 flags. Glenghiscan got 3 games left to finish and needs just 3 flags to secure his place in the semi-finals.
